DEC issued a proposed permit allowing Hilcorp to discharge 12.4 million gallons of treated seawater daily into Stefansson Sound near Nuiqsut, reviving an authorization that expired in late 2022.

Deadhorse Airport paving is set for mid-July as crews work through the Arctic construction season to fix aging pavement and drainage that support North Slope oil and gas operations.

On the roadless North Slope, a snow trail is how cut-off villages get winter fuel. A Native-owned company builds it — across fragile tundra and caribou country.
